Abstract
The utility model discloses a kind of laser cutting machines, including receiving hopper, the both sides of the top of receiving hopper are installed with lathe bed, rack and pinion drive mechanism is fixedly mounted on lathe bed, the linear guide is fixedly mounted in the inside of rack and pinion drive mechanism, workbench portion is fixedly mounted in the inside of the linear guide, the lower right of workbench portion is equipped with electric control box, laser placement cabinet is provided on the right side of electric control box, lathe bed cover part is fixedly mounted in the both sides of receiving hopper, rack and pinion drive mechanism and the linear guide are equipped with slidable lathe bed cover part, header portion is equipped with slidable Z axis part.The utility model laser cutting machine, header portion can horizontally slip in the linear guide, Z axis part can be slided on header portion, ensure when being cut to the product on workbench portion, it is cut into desired shape, human resources are greatly saved, the working efficiency of cutting is accelerated, ensure that the accuracy of cutting.
